Hedgehunter heads huge National entry
Willie Mullins’ 10-year-old romped to a 14-length victory over Royal Auclair in the four-and-a-half-mile showpiece and is due to continue his build-up at Aintree in the Hennessy Cognac Gold Cup at Leopardstown on Sunday week.
Clan Royal, runner-up in 2004 and leading when carried out by a loose horse at Becher’s Brook last year, could bid to make it third time lucky for trainer Jonjo O’Neill and owner JP McManus.
